Subject: Re: [PATCH v2.49 1/6] ofp-actions: Consider L4 actions after
 mpls_push as inconsistent

On Fri, Nov 15, 2013 at 04:50:53PM +0900, Simon Horman wrote:
> After an mpls_push action the resulting packet is MPLS and
> the MPLS payload is opaque. Thus nothing can be assumed
> about the packets network protocol and it is inconsistent
> to apply L4 actions.
> 
> With regards to actions that affect the packet at other layers
> of the protocol stack:
> 
> * L3: The consistency of L3 actions should already be handled correctly
>   by virtue of the dl_type of the flow being temporarily altered
>   during consistency checking by both push_mpls and pop_mpls actions.
> 
> * MPLS: The consistency checking of MPLS actions appear to already be
>   handled correctly.
> 
> * VLAN: At this time Open vSwitch on mpls_push an MPLS LSE is always
>   added after any VLAN tags that follow the ethernet header.
>   That is the tag ordering defined prior to OpenFlow1.3. As such
>   VLAN actions should sill be equally valid before and after mpls_push
>   and mpls_pop actions.
> 
> * L2 actions are equally valid before and after mpls_push and mpls_pop actions.
